If user has HOME env var, Html5 packaging creates .emscripten folder within the location specified by HOME, not the expected intermediate location(like C:\Program Files\Epic Games\4.13\Engine\Intermediate\Build\HTML5\.emscripten). This causes packaging to fail.
1. Add HOME env var to the PC, and points to some directory
2. Create a new First Person Project
3. Try to create a html5 package
4. packaging fails with C:\Program Files\Epic Games\4.13\Engine\Intermediate\Build\HTML5\.emscripten not found error
